Strong's Greek #2370 - θυμιάω thumiaó (to burn incense)


Original Word: θυμιάω
Transliteration: thumiaó
Definition: to burn incense
Part of Speech: Verb
Phonetic Spelling: (thoo-mee-ah'-o)

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

burn incense.

From a derivative of thuo (in the sense of smoking); to fumigate, i.e. Offer aromatic fumes -- burn incense.

see GREEK thuo


Thayer's Greek Lexicon

Strong's 2370: θυμιάω

θυμιάω, θυμιω: 1 aorist infinitive θυμιάσαι (R G θυμασαι); (from θῦμα, and this from θύω, which see); in Greek writings from Pindar, Herodotus, Plato down; the Sept. for קִטֵּר and הִקְטִיר; to burn incense: Luke 1:9.
